在Linux上部署Kafka时,选择合适的版本至关重要。以下是一些考虑因素和建议,帮助您做出明智的选择:
选择Kafka版本时的考虑因素
- 性能需求:高吞吐量或低延迟的应用场景需要考虑不同版本的性能特性。
- 兼容性:确保所选版本与现有系统和组件兼容,特别是与其他软件和服务的集成。
- 社区支持:选择一个有活跃社区支持的版本,以便在遇到问题时能够快速获得帮助。
- 新特性:考虑是否需要Kafka的新特性,如事务支持、幂等性等。
- 改进和修复:查看版本更新日志,了解每个版本引入了哪些改进和修复。
Kafka版本选择建议
- 最新稳定版:通常推荐使用最新稳定版,以获得最新的功能和安全更新。但是,如果当前版本与您的系统环境不兼容,可能需要回退到之前的稳定版本。
- 长期支持(LTS)版本:如果您需要更长时间的软件支持和稳定性,可以考虑选择长期支持版本。
版本升级或降级时的注意事项
- 在进行版本升级或降级时,仔细研究版本变迁日志,了解新版本或旧版本之间的主要变化,包括API改动、配置文件调整等。
- 测试新版本在测试环境中的表现,确保其与现有系统的兼容性。
- 备份重要数据和配置文件,以防升级或降级过程中出现问题。
通过上述步骤和建议,您可以更加明智地选择在Linux上部署的Kafka版本,确保其满足您的业务需求和技术要求。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>